Lot no. 117
GAULLE Charles de. L. A. S. "Charles", Aleppo Tuesday [26 November 1929], to his wife Yvonne de GAULLE in Beirut; 3 pages and a half in-8 headed Réunion des officiers d'Alep. Tender letter to his wife during a mission to Syria. "My dear little wife, I shall not be returning to Beirut until next Monday or Tuesday, as I want to complete my military inspection as thoroughly as possible before the rains. Yesterday I drove to Rayak where I took a plane to Aleppo. Arrived in Aleppo in the afternoon. [...] This morning rounds of the troops and services. This afternoon reconnaissance in the direction of Antioch after lunching with General Pichot-Duclos. Tomorrow morning departure for the Euphrates by car. Overnight at Deir-ez-Zor. Thursday Hassenelé and Kamechlié (bed). Friday, visit to Turkish border posts. Saturday and Sunday return via Ras-el-Ain and Tell-Ahiad. Overnight in Aleppo on Sunday evening. Then return to Beirut via Latakia and Tripoli. [...] The people of Aleppo are quite happy with their lot, but they find themselves much campier than those in Beirut. It's cold in the evening and I think it's the same in Beirut. I love you with all my heart. Everyone here asks me: "And Madame de G. wasn't too impressed by this start to the campaign?" I answer the truth i.e. "no" and I think apart from myself that she may have been but that she is so brave and courageous that she pretended to be pleased. And I love her so, so much! I'll never forget how much you supported me at what was a very difficult time"... LNC, I, p. 725.
